BREAKING: No. 1 Women’s Basketball Recruit Aaliyah Chavez Commits to South Carolina Over LSU, Auburn, and Tennessee

In a monumental move for college women’s basketball, Aaliyah Chavez, the nation’s top-ranked recruit for the 2025 class, has announced her commitment to the University of South Carolina. The 5-star guard from Monterey High School in California chose the Gamecocks over powerhouse programs LSU, Auburn, and Tennessee, signaling a significant shift in the landscape of women’s college basketball.ESPN.com+3YouTube+3Instagram+3

A Transformative Talent

Chavez is widely regarded as one of the most dynamic and versatile players in recent memory. Standing at 5’10”, she possesses a rare combination of size, speed, and skill that allows her to excel both as a scorer and playmaker. Her ability to impact the game on both ends of the floor has drawn comparisons to some of the game’s greats. During her high school career, she led Monterey to multiple state championships and earned numerous accolades, including being named the Gatorade California Player of the Year.

The Recruiting Battle

Chavez’s recruitment was one of the most closely watched in recent years, with several elite programs vying for her commitment. LSU, under head coach Kim Mulkey, has been a dominant force in women’s college basketball, consistently securing top-tier talent. Auburn, led by head coach Johnnie Harris, has been on the rise and was eager to add Chavez to its roster. Tennessee, with its rich basketball tradition, also made a strong push to land the top recruit. However, Chavez ultimately decided that South Carolina, guided by the legendary Dawn Staley, offered the best environment for her to develop and compete at the highest level.
